Web20 Oct 2011 · Be wary of plucking an older horse out of retirement (or even semi-retirement) and putting him back to work. Even if you introduce him slowly to his new exercise routine, chronic conditions and whatever soundness issues forced him into retirement in the first place may crop up again. Know Where Your Hay Comes From. If you feed alfalfa hay, it’s very important to know what region of the country it’s coming from to determine the possibility of blister beetles. Blister beetles are most commonly found in the east, south, and ...
